Chelsea's full of classy gastropubs, where the casual drinker feels a little bit intimidated by the omnipresent cutlery and £20-a-main menu. The Pig's Ear is different, though. It has a relaxed vibe, with a couple of interesting real ales (including the pub's own Pig's Ear brew). Better yet, there's a booze-food demarcation. The front bar is very much for for the drinker, while the back bistro room and upstairs dining room cater for the diner. Prices can be a bit steep, but you won't be disappointed by the grub. Unless you order the snails; but then snails are never worth eating.
